What Is The History of the Pound?
The pound has been many different weights. Merchants in medieval England used one pound for wool and another for silver; apothecaries had a third; and for centuries the difference between them was a matter of local custom rather than law. That the pound is now a single exact number, identical in Boston and Birmingham, took roughly two thousand years and a treaty.
A kilogram is the base unit of mass in the metric system, defined since 2019 by the Planck constant rather than a lump of platinum in a Paris vault. A pound — the avoirdupois pound used across the United States and still common in the United Kingdom — is fixed by international agreement at exactly 0.45359237 kilograms. Because both units are pinned to the same agreed definition, converting between kilograms and pounds is exact arithmetic, not an estimate.

Mistakes Worth Avoiding
Watch for these and you will not need to double-check your work:
- Reading a comma as a decimal point: Much of Europe writes 2,5 kg where the UK and US write 2.5 kg. Copying a figure across that boundary without checking is a classic import-paperwork error.
- Assuming a US pound differs from a UK pound: It does not. Since 1959 both are exactly 0.45359237 kg. The confusion usually comes from tons, gallons or fluid ounces, which genuinely do differ.
- Multiplying when you should divide: It is the single most common error, and it is off by a factor of nearly five. If your answer looks too big, you probably multiplied a pound figure by 2.20462 instead of by 0.453592.
- Mixing up mass and force: Pounds and kilograms both describe mass in everyday use. Pound-force is a different quantity. Unless you are doing engineering statics, you want the avoirdupois pound.
- Trusting 2.2 for large loads: Rounding the factor to 2.2 costs you about 0.2 percent. On 5 kg nobody notices. On 500 kg that is a whole kilogram gone missing.
- Confusing pounds with stones: Fourteen pounds make a stone. A reader who reads 11 st 4 lb as 11.4 lb is out by a factor of fourteen, which is a memorable kind of wrong.
Where the Numbers Come From
In 1959 six countries signed the International Yard and Pound Agreement and settled something that had been slightly untidy for centuries: exactly how heavy a pound is. The answer they agreed on was 0.45359237 kilograms, and that definition has not been touched since. It is the reason a conversion done in Sydney matches one done in Chicago.
The kilogram itself has had a more eventful time. From 1889 it was defined by a platinum-iridium cylinder kept near Paris, which meant the world's unit of mass was a physical object that could in principle be scratched. In 2019 that changed: the kilogram is now defined through the Planck constant, a fixed number of nature rather than a lump of metal in a safe.
None of this changes the arithmetic you use for the pound's history, and that is rather the point. A well-chosen definition is one you never have to think about. Multiply by 2.20462262185, or by 0.45359237 going the other way, and the standards infrastructure behind those digits does its work quietly.

When Extra Decimals Stop Helping
It is worth separating two different things: how precisely the units are defined, and how precisely you can measure. The definition is exact to infinite precision. Your measurement almost certainly is not, and the answer should never claim more accuracy than the input had.
The general rule is to carry full precision through the calculation and round once at the very end, to whatever your context genuinely needs. Rounding an input, then rounding an intermediate step, then rounding the answer is how three small and individually defensible decisions add up to a number that is simply wrong.
Two decimals is usually plenty
For almost everything on this page, two decimal places answers the question. 0.45 kg shows as 1 lbs, and the digits beyond that describe a quantity too small to weigh on any equipment you are likely to be using.
When to keep more
Bulk quantities, repeated multiplications and anything that feeds a further calculation all deserve full precision until the last step. The error from early rounding does not stay put — it scales with everything you multiply it by afterwards.

Two Systems, One Practical Skill
Fluency in both measurement systems is a genuinely useful thing, and it is not the same as knowing the conversion factor. Fluency means having a feel for what the numbers mean — knowing that 70 kg is an average adult, that 25 kg is a heavy bag of something, that a tonne is a small car.
That intuition is what catches errors. Somebody who knows roughly what a kilogram feels like will notice immediately when a calculation produces a person weighing 700 kg, whereas somebody working purely with digits will not. Anchor points do more practical work than memorised factors.
The good news is that anchors are easy to build. Pick half a dozen weights you encounter regularly, learn them in both units, and the rest follows by comparison. Most people find that a fortnight of paying attention is enough.

What is the avoirdupois pound?
The everyday pound, made of 16 ounces, used for general goods. The name comes from Old French aveir de peis, meaning goods of weight.
When did the pound become exactly 0.45359237 kg?
1 July 1959, under the International Yard and Pound Agreement signed by the United States, United Kingdom, Canada, Australia, New Zealand and South Africa.
What is a troy pound?
0.3732417 kg, made of 12 troy ounces, used for precious metals. It is lighter than the avoirdupois pound despite the shared name.
Did the US and UK pounds differ before 1959?
Very slightly. The US pound was 0.4535924277 kg and the UK pound 0.45359243 kg. The 1959 agreement rounded both to a common exact value.

Why do some countries use kg and others lbs?
History rather than logic. The metric system spread through legislation and trade from the 1790s; countries that industrialised earlier under imperial units kept them in everyday life.
Where does the conversion factor come from?
The International Yard and Pound Agreement of 1959, which fixed the pound at exactly 0.45359237 kilograms across the English-speaking world.
Does the pound differ between countries?
Not the avoirdupois pound. Since 1959 the US, UK, Canada, Australia, New Zealand and South Africa have all used exactly 0.45359237 kg. Tons and gallons are a different story.

Does gravity change the conversion?
Not the conversion. Kilograms to pounds is a fixed ratio between two units of mass. Gravity affects what a scale measures, not the arithmetic between units.
Why is the kilogram the only base unit with a prefix?
A historical accident. The gram was originally the base unit, but it proved too small to be practical, so the kilogram was adopted while keeping the name.
